一、需求背景:
- 支持某软件园区618大促(商品集市)。(1)用户端需求:活动发布、用户注册、优惠券领取。(2)商户端需求:商户报名(需审核)、优惠券核验,优惠券核验数据统计。
- 时间节点:从提出需求到上线共6天(出方案+UI设计+前后端开发+测试)。
二、遇到问题及解决方案
- 多角色设计
小程序要满足商家和用户两个使用场景,产品设计中要考虑商家和用户两种身份的切换,既要保证业务方的需求功能点正常,又要保证单个主体在商家和用户的权益中的交并关系。 - 用户信息拉取
(1)获取可行性:用户信息对于任何一家公司来说都是极为宝贵的财富,在设计之初就要确定好拉取的用户信息门类,所在公司为新职业教育行业,因此软件园区的用户信息对我们来说具有很大的跟进价值,一般来说微信用户的openid、手机号、地理位置、unionid都是可以通过小程序内用户授权获取(openid和unionid的区别见博文:https://blog.youkuaiyun.com/weixin_45334587/article/details/106811596),其余的信息就可以通过在某些关键功能点添加表单让用户填写来采